Quite straight talk from Hänninen. "I would lie if I said I wasn't pissed off" when learned about not having a seat at TGR for 2018.
Juho also says that while it "probably would be possible to rent a car from M-Sport" (in 2018) he won't do that as that road has already been seen.
Regarding the future he says that there are "no specific plans", but that he hasn't retired and is willing to drive again "as long as the offer makes sense" (presumably meaning that from sporting point of view). "Let's drive in Wales and then see where we are".

The occasions when the world champion has left the team:
1979 Waldegård with Ford (and Mercedes) --> 1980 to Mercedes, Fiat and Toyota
1981 Vatanen with Ford -- 1982 to private Ford (because Ford works team didn't run in 1982)
1982 Röhrl with Opel --> 1983 to Lancia
1986 Kankkunen with Peugeot --> 1987 to Lancia (because Peugeot didn't continue in Group A)
1987 Kankkunen with Lancia --> 1988 to Toyota
1992 Sainz with Toyota --> 1993 to Lancia
2001 Burns with Subaru --> 2002 to Peugeot
2016 Ogier with VW --> 2017 to M-Sport (because VW quit)
